Roma Agrawal is an Associate Structural Engineer at engineering company WSP. She is responsible for making buildings and bridges stand up.

Sayara Beg is a Data Scientist and STEM Ambassador. Her role involves project management (monitoring all aspects of a project, from the initial planning to the very end, to ensure it runs efficiently and achieves what it set out to do) and statistical analysis.

This series of videos, named Recollections, shows how Werner von Siemens, who had an inventive mind and a knack for new technology, went from being a soldier to building a global corporation. It is a good example of how careers can change dramatically and persistence has its rewards.
